Elmer Township (Oscoda County), MI has a lower rate of violent crime than the national average, with a reported rate of 12.4 compared to the U.S. average of 22.7. Similarly, the property crime rate in Elmer Township is also lower than the nation-wide average, at 26.8 compared to 35.4 for the U.S. as a whole. This suggests that Elmer Township may be a safer place to live than many other areas of the country.
Crime is ranked on a scale of 1 (low crime) to 100 (high crime)
